In the intricate world of artificial intelligence, data engineering stands as the unsung hero—a disciplined process that transforms raw data into a polished gem ready for AI modeling. While the algorithms and models often take the spotlight, the true magic begins much earlier, with the careful planning, structuring, and management of data pipelines. Let’s overview the critical steps of data engineering, exploring their interconnected roles and the undeniable benefits they bring to effective AI implementation.
The Journey Through Data Engineering
Every
robust data pipeline begins with Data Acquisition Strategies, the art of
identifying and collecting data from diverse sources. Whether it is
transactional databases, IoT devices, or external APIs, this step lays the
groundwork for capturing the breadth and depth of data required for AI insights.
Strategic acquisition ensures that no valuable piece of information is
overlooked, enabling a pipeline enriched with diversity and relevance.
Once the
data is acquired, it must move through the pipeline efficiently. Data
Ingestion and Transformation become key here, involving techniques like
batch processing for bulk data and real-time processing for dynamic, fast-paced
environments. Transformation ensures that raw data is cleansed, enriched, and
aligned with the desired formats, making it not only accessible but also
meaningful for downstream applications.
Structured
and normalized data forms the backbone of AI modeling. Data Structuring and
Normalization organize chaotic datasets into structured tables, eliminating
redundancies and ensuring consistency. This step transforms an overwhelming
mess into a streamlined and logical structure, unlocking the potential for
deeper analysis and interpretation.
For AI to
make sense of this structured data, Feature Engineering steps in, acting
as the creative architect of predictive power. By creating meaningful inputs
from raw data—whether through aggregation, derivation, or encoding—this stage
bridges the gap between raw numbers and actionable insights. Well-engineered
features are like a carefully chosen lens, sharpening the focus of AI models
and boosting their predictive accuracy.
As data
pipelines grow to accommodate larger datasets and more complex AI demands,
scalability becomes non-negotiable. Scaling Data Pipelines ensures that
your infrastructure can handle not only today’s data but also tomorrow’s
exponential growth. A scalable pipeline protects against bottlenecks, enabling
seamless processing without sacrificing speed or accuracy.
In the age
of immediacy, Real-Time Data Processing takes center stage. This
component empowers businesses to react to events as they happen, whether
monitoring cybersecurity threats or adapting to shifting consumer trends.
Real-time capabilities turn pipelines into dynamic engines of immediate value,
aligning decision-making with the speed of the modern world.
However,
with great power comes great responsibility. Data Validation and Error
Handling safeguard pipeline integrity, catching discrepancies and ensuring
every piece of data meets quality standards. From identifying outliers to
implementing automated checks, this stage ensures that flawed data does not
compromise AI outcomes.
Security is
another cornerstone. Data Security and Access Control protect sensitive
information from breaches while ensuring that the right data is accessible to
the right people at the right time. Implementing robust encryption,
authentication protocols, and role-based access is essential for building trust
and meeting compliance requirements.
Finally, Data
Quality Assessment acts as the ultimate quality control, ensuring the
entire pipeline delivers data that is accurate, reliable, and fit for purpose.
By leveraging techniques like profiling, audits, and error-rate tracking, this
stage ensures that the data is primed for success, unlocking AI models' full
potential.
The
Bigger Picture
Each of
these steps contributes to a harmonious data pipeline, where each component
strengthens the next. Together, they create a resilient system that supports
effective AI modeling, ensuring that data flows smoothly, is prepared
optimally, and remains secure and reliable throughout its journey. When
organizations invest in their data pipelines, they are not just managing data;
they are building the foundation for long-term AI success.
Looking
Ahead
This blog
cycle has been a deep exploration of the transformative power of data
engineering for AI. Every theme we presented is critical for constructing a
data pipeline that is robust, scalable, and ready to fuel intelligent systems.
To consolidate these insights, we are thrilled to announce the upcoming release
of our Journal No. 4: Data Engineering for AI Success. This journal will
provide an in-depth exploration of these topics, offering practical guidance
and actionable strategies for professionals looking to harness the power of
data engineering.
Stay tuned
for more updates and resources as we continue our journey in the world of AI
and data innovation!
(Authors: Suzana, Anjoum, at InfoSet)
No comments:
Post a Comment